Sodium carbonate and sodium bicarbonate are two of the major components of soda ash. In a 5.00 g sample of soda ash, there is 2.27 g of sodium carbonate and 1.09 g of sodium bicarbonate. Calculate for the percent composition of sodium carbonate and sodium bicarbonate in the sample.

Given: Total sample of soda ash = 5 grams

            Sodium carbonate = 2.27 grams

            Sodium bicarbonate = 1.09 grams

To find: Percent composition of sodium carbonate and sodium bicarbonate in sample

Solution: Total sample = 5 grams

Other component in sample = 5 - ( 2.27 + 1.09)

                                               = 5 - 3.36

                                               = 1.64 grams

Percentage of sodium carbonate = (mass of sodium carbonate/total sample) ×100

                                                       = (2.27/5)×100

                                                       = 45.4%

Percentage of sodium bicarbonate in sample = (mass of sodium bicarbonate/total sample)×100

= (1.09/5)×100

= 21.8 %

Therefore, the percent composition of sodium carbonate in the sample is 45.4% and of sodium bicarbonate in the sample is 21.8%.
